May 13, 2022 NHTSA CAMPAIGN NUMBER: 22V334000

Forward-Facing Camera is Misaligned

A front-facing camera that is not functioning properly may restrict or disable certain features including Pre-Collision Assist, Adaptive Cruise Control, Lane Keeping System, Driver Alert, and Auto High Beam Control, increasing the risk of a crash.

NHTSA Campaign Number: 22V334

Manufacturer Ford Motor Company

Components FORWARD COLLISION AVOIDANCE

Potential Number of Units Affected 32

Summary

Ford Motor Company (Ford) is recalling certain 2022 Mustang vehicles equipped with an Image Processing Module A (IPMA) or forward-facing camera. The camera is misaligned to the vehicle, resulting in the camera not functioning as intended.

Remedy

Dealers will realign the front-facing camera, free of charge. Owner notification letters are expected to be mailed May 30, 2022. Owners may contact Ford customer service at 1-866-436-7332. Ford’s number for this recall is 22S34.
